Final comments
If you want to meet many international people and make a lot of fun and not spend to much: this is your place. There is so much social life that study becomes less and less important.

Housing
Type of housing: On campus
Arranged by: Host university
If returning, I would choose: On campus
Why?
That is where the action is and all other exchange student are
